背景
Google AdSense 是许多网站用来获取收益的重要方式,但是在一些情况下,我们可能需要手动刷新一个包含广告的区域以保证广告内容的实时性和展现效果。本文将介绍如何通过 JavaScript 实现这个功能。
实现思路
Google AdSense 提供了 <script>
标签和 google_ad_client
参数来自动生成广告代码,我们可以在需要展示广告的位置插入这段代码,然后通过 JavaScript 来控制这个包含广告的区域进行定时刷新。
具体地,我们可以使用 jQuery 框架中的 load()
方法来异步加载广告内容,并设置定时器函数来执行刷新操作。在刷新时,我们需要首先移除该区域原有的广告内容,然后再次调用 load()
方法重新加载新的广告内容。
以下是示例代码:
-- -------------------- ---- ------- --------- ----- ------ ------ --------------- - --- ---- --- - ------ -- ------ ---------- -------- ----------------------------------------------------------- -------- ----------------------- ---------- ----------- - ------------------------------------------------------ ------------------------ ------- -- ------- --- ------------------------------ - --------------- ----- ---------- ------- ------ ----- ------------------ ------ ---- ------ ------- -- --- --------- ----------------------- ------------------- - -------------------------- ----------------- - ------------- ------------------ - ---- ------------------- - --- ----------- --------- ---------------------- ------------------------------------------------------------------ ------- ------- -------
学习建议
除了实现刷新功能外,我们还可以考虑对广告内容进行优化,提高广告的点击率和转化率。例如,我们可以通过调整广告的位置、颜色、大小等来优化广告的展现效果。
此外,由于 Google AdSense 有一些比较严格的规定和要求,我们在使用时需要仔细阅读官方文档和政策条款,以免触犯相关规定。
总结
本文介绍了如何通过 JavaScript 实现对包含 Google 广告的 DIV 区域进行定时刷新的功能。同时,我们也提到了一些优化广告效果的方法和注意事项。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/25937